Spontaneous peri‐aortic hematoma in a patient with new‐onset chest pain
Abstract Peri‐aortic hematoma formation is a common sequela of esophageal rupture and aortic dissection, but non‐traumatic spontaneous hematoma formation is an uncommon finding.
